Julian E.C. Sabisch is a scholar working on Mechanical Engineering, Materials Chemistry and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Julian E.C. Sabisch has authored 17 papers receiving a total of 387 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Mechanical Engineering, 10 papers in Materials Chemistry and 3 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Julian E.C. Sabisch’s work include Microstructure and mechanical properties (6 papers), Hydrogen embrittlement and corrosion behaviors in metals (3 papers) and Magnesium Alloys for Biomedical Applications (3 papers). Julian E.C. Sabisch is often cited by papers focused on Microstructure and mechanical properties (6 papers), Hydrogen embrittlement and corrosion behaviors in metals (3 papers) and Magnesium Alloys for Biomedical Applications (3 papers). Julian E.C. Sabisch collaborates with scholars based in United States, Germany and Serbia. Julian E.C. Sabisch's co-authors include Andrew M. Minor, Gao Liu, Erica T. Lilleodden, Mingyan Wu, Vincent Battaglia, Douglas L. Medlin, Abraham Anapolsky, Xiangyun Song, Leyun Wang and Philip Noell and has published in prestigious journals such as Nano Letters, Acta Materialia and Journal of the American Ceramic Society.
